In depth · editorial + model · written 2026-07-13
Air Products is one of the handful of industrial-gas majors that build and run on-site plants and supply the bulk and specialty gases semiconductor fabs consume — nitrogen, oxygen, hydrogen and the ultra-pure process gases used in etching and deposition. In the chain it is a deep upstream supplier to the foundry layer: fabs cannot run without a continuous, contamination-free gas supply piped in at scale.
Its structural hook is the stickiness of on-site supply. Once a gas company builds a plant beside a fab under a long-term contract, it becomes embedded infrastructure that is costly and disruptive to switch, giving durable, utility-like exposure to fab expansion. The model places it at a modest centrality because the gases are essential but commoditised inputs, several layers removed from the accelerators — critical to keep fabs running, but not the scarce bottleneck themselves.
